The high-use living style is one of the symbols of city-life pattern in our modern society Living style in Seoul has been changed rapidly from low-rise to high-rise during the last several decades of industrialization with national issues for economy and other social changes with globalization and rapid westernizaiton in life style The Seoul has experienced serious housing problems with excessive rural-to-urban migration It quantitatively resulted rapid housing demands in limited land resources and inevitably resulted multi-story residence development. This habitat called apartment has become typical living quarter of city life based on modern society with globalization and westernization This pattern seems to be a way to solve the quantitative problem, but it brought another problem such as uniform visual environment with similar building height and form Turning into the 21st century, such a mechanism becomes no longer effective and there are demands for the diversification of residential style and amenity of urban housing. The high-rise residence has been lead with residential complex and height competitions in Seoul.
This paper has focused on the comparative analysis of residential developments to obtain architectural design characteristics of high-rise residential patterns in relation to the user's evaluation for developing the adequacy of living quality It will be chance to understand developed design patterns of multi-story residential buildings with the changes of the times in Seoul
